Lugano

Lugano (Latin language: Luganum) is a city of the district Lugano in the canton of Ticino in Switzerland.

Since 2004 the former municipalities of Breganzona, Cureggia, Davesco-Soragno, Gandria, Pambio-Noranco, Pazzallo, Pregassona and Viganello were incorporated into the city. In 2008, they were followed by Barbengo, Carabbia and Villa Luganese.[5] In 2013 the former municipalities of Bogno, Cadro, Carona, Certara, Cimadera, Sonvico and Valcolla were incorporated into the city.
